Tasting notes

Offers aromas of citrus, green apple, and wet stone. The palate is precise and mineral-driven with flavors of lemon zest, green apple, and a crisp, refreshing finish.

Expert ratings

Robert Parker 92/100

"The 2022 Chablis 'Les Grands Terroirs' from Domaine Samuel Billaud showcases aromas of green apple, citrus, and chalky minerality. The palate is precise and focused, with vibrant acidity and flavors of lemon, pear, and a hint of oyster shell. The finish is long and mineral-driven, reflecting the wine's terroir."

More About The Winery

The Billaud family has been producing outstanding Chablis since 1815, and today Samuel Billaud, the 6th generation, is recognized as one of the region’s most talented winemakers. After establishing his own domaine in 2010, Samuel quickly rose from a “rising star” to being regarded among the very best in Chablis, alongside Raveneau and Dauvissat.

Samuel Billaud crafts terroir-driven wines of extraordinary precision and vibrancy. From the crisp, steely freshness of Petit Chablis to the depth and complexity of his Premier and Grand Crus, his wines crackle with minerality, tension, and elegance, perfectly capturing the essence of Chablis’ Kimmeridgian limestone soils.

International critics, including Neal Martin, consistently praise Billaud’s wines for their singular clarity and poise. They are the embodiment of purity, finesse, and ageing potential, making them highly sought after by collectors and sommeliers worldwide.
